Family Sheet
HUSBAND
Name: Jacob SnookMale [1] Note
Born: 25 Nov 1803 1803-11-25 at NJ Or NY NJ Or NY
Married: 1826 1826-1-1 at PA PA
Died: 21 Jul 1890 1890-7-21 at Bactavia, Jefferson Iowa Bactavia, Jefferson Iowa
Father: Koonrad Peter Snook Jr
Mother: Mary Aber
WIFE
Name: Sarah Sally Price [5]
Born: 26 Jul 1803 at PA
Died: 29 Aug 1873
CHILDREN
Name: Peter Snook
Born: Abt 1827 at PA
Died: Apr 1902 at Stuart, Jefferson Co
Born: Nov 1828 at Johnson Co, PA
Died: 9 May 1926 at Batavia, Iowa
Husband: William James
Name: Joseph Snook
Born: Abt 1831 at PA
Died: Apr 1868
Name: Esther Snook
Born: Abt 1832 at PA
Died:
Born: 1834 at PA
Died: 1910
Husband: George James
Born: 1 Oct 1839 at Richland County, Ohio
Died: 12 Nov 1926 at Fairfield County, Iowa
Husband: Archibald (archie) Richardson
Born: 20 Sep 1842 at Richland Co, Ohio
Died: 18 Aug 1925 at Batavia
Husband: Obed R. Ward
Name: Betsy Snook
Born: Abt 1844 at Ohio
Died:
Born: Abt 1846 at Iowa
Died: 1915
Wife: Anna Mariah Marion
Name: Emily Snook
Born: Abt 1848 at Iowa
Died:

NOTES
1). 18401.ged Field Ledger Wed., July 23, 1890 Page 3, Col 2 Jacob Snook died Monday, in Batavia, at the home of his daughter, Mrs.Hardin he was the father of Mrs. A. Richardson of this city. He was of 86 years of age.
